The Social Network is a 2010 biographical drama film directed by David Fincher and written by Aaron Sorkin. The movie is based on the life of Mark Zuckerberg, the co-founder and CEO of Facebook, and his journey to create the social media giant. The film was a critical and commercial success, grossing over $224 million worldwide.
